The prices of several food commodities in Indonesia today are observed to have decreased compared to yesterday.

According to data from the National Food Agency (Bapanas) food price panel on Friday (September 19, 2025) at 09:15 AM WIB, out of 25 commodities, 2 commodities increased and 23 commodities decreased.

The commodities with increased prices are Mackerel and lean beef.

Meanwhile, the prices of several commodities such as shallots, SPHP rice, table salt, granulated sugar, and Minyakita decreased compared to yesterday''s prices.

Mackerel prices rose the highest by Rp669 (1.59%) to Rp42,638 per kg. Meanwhile, red bird''s eye chili prices fell the sharpest by Rp2,985 (6.16%) to Rp45,459 per kg.

The following is a complete list of 25 food commodity prices in Indonesia according to Bapanas on September 19, 2025, at 09:15 AM WIB.

  1. Fresh Local Buffalo Meat: Rp138,000 per kg (down 2.16%)
  2. Lean Beef: Rp135,175 per kg (up 0.11%)
  3. Frozen Imported Buffalo Meat: Rp103,079 per kg (down 2.8%)
  4. Curly Red Chili: Rp55,855 per kg (down 5.24%)
  5. Large Red Chili: Rp45,859 per kg (down 5.0%)
  6. Red Bird''s Eye Chili: Rp45,459 per kg (down 6.16%)
  7. Mackerel: Rp42,638 per kg (up 1.59%)
  8. Shallots: Rp39,661 per kg (down 2.99%)
  9. Broiler Chicken Meat: Rp37,589 per kg (down 1.61%)
  10. Garlic Bulb: Rp36,608 per kg (down 2.3%)
  11. Skipjack Tuna: Rp34,514 per kg (down 0.9%)
  12. Milkfish: Rp34,454 per kg (down 2.27%)
  13. Broiler Chicken Eggs: Rp29,727 per kg (down 0.32%)
  14. Packaged Cooking Oil: Rp20,605 per liter (down 1.26%)
  15. Granulated Sugar: Rp18,000 per kg (down 0.49%)
  16. Bulk Cooking Oil: Rp17,386 per liter (down 0.67%)
  17. Minyakita: Rp17,313 per liter (down 0.87%)
  18. Premium Rice: Rp15,868 per kg (down 0.86%)
  19. Medium Rice: Rp13,626 per kg (down 1.83%)
  20. Packaged Wheat Flour: Rp12,667 per kg (down 2.24%)
  21. SPHP Rice: Rp12,519 per kg (down 0.22%)
  22. Table Salt: Rp11,331 per kg (down 2.39%)
  23. Dried Imported Soybean Seeds: Rp10,508 per kg (down 1.77%)
  24. Bulk Wheat Flour: Rp9,519 per kg (down 2.3%)
  25. Corn at Farmer Level: Rp6,364 per kg (down 3.58%)
